Subject: DR drill — health checks, Halcyard gateway

Dear plugin authors: next week's disaster-recovery drill will intentionally fail health checks behind the Halcyard load balancer. Ensure your plugins respond to the readiness probe within two seconds, or they will be drained. Results will be published afterward. To access the drill's standby console during the exercise, enter the passphrase below.

unlock words, fafop-hawep: briwyn-oliix-sorox

Escalation — SproutCycle watering scheduler. If scheduled watering jobs stop dispatching, first check the valve-gateway heartbeat panel; a missed heartbeat older than 30 minutes means the gateway bridge is down, not the scheduler. Restart the bridge service once. If jobs still queue without firing, capture the dispatcher log from the last hour and open an incident. For anything beyond one restart, escalate to the greenhouse platform team.

escalation mailbox, bafog-fafog: ulador@paliqlabs.internal

Subject: LiftSim cut-over complete

Cut-over of the Averno elevator-dispatch simulator to the new Cartwheel cluster finished at 02:10. Dispatch latency models revalidated; variance under 2%. Old Bramleigh nodes drained and powered down. Two minor issues: a stale cache on the car-allocation worker (flushed) and one failed canary, rerun clean. Rollback window closes Friday. No further action needed from release side. For the record, the active post-cut-over configuration values follow.

config for kafof-bawef:
holath:
  log_level: debug
  metrics_host: metrics.holath.qorvelsys.internal
  pin: 2191
  pool_size: 32

Ticket #977 — SquatGuard scanner keeps dropping its DB connection mid-scan. Heads up for whoever inherits this: the typo-squatting package scanner runs fine for ~20 minutes, then the pool exhausts and every lookup against the package-name corpus fails. Probably we're leaking connections in the similarity checker, but nobody's confirmed. To poke at it yourself, run the scanner against the staging corpus database via the connection string below.

primary connection of yagep-kahip = redis://giliel_svc:zYiKsLL2PLpfPL@db-348f.xolmarsys.corp:5432/fenwyn